Output d8a95abc9080bebb01ea08235c1ef0c64ba0be21b2654ecb281f64edcfb687ac:0

value
2421426
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 039c8568831d87e58b0abd433c3aed488753a1fa OP_EQUALVERIFY OP_CHECKSIG
address
1L6XrXntWGCtNTnTTnrVW2zkhpKEdVEoS
transaction
d8a95abc9080bebb01ea08235c1ef0c64ba0be21b2654ecb281f64edcfb687ac
spent
true